From c6657af250b1a6517ca8dede6d8d98fad4ba1a10 Mon Sep 17 00:00:00 2001 From: falkTX Date: Fri, 24 Feb 2023 14:11:04 +0100 Subject: [PATCH] Cleanup BASE_OPTS usage, matching DPF Signed-off-by: falkTX --- source/Makefile.mk | 15 ++++----------- 1 file changed, 4 insertions(+), 11 deletions(-) diff --git a/source/Makefile.mk b/source/Makefile.mk index 29e952397..a100e3197 100644 --- a/source/Makefile.mk +++ b/source/Makefile.mk @@ -25,19 +25,12 @@ include $(CWD)/Makefile.deps.mk BASE_FLAGS = -Wall -Wextra -pipe -DBUILDING_CARLA -DREAL_BUILD -MD -MP -fno-common BASE_OPTS = -O3 -ffast-math -fdata-sections -ffunction-sections -ifeq ($(CPU_I386_OR_X86_64),true) -BASE_OPTS += -mtune=generic ifeq ($(WASM),true) -# BASE_OPTS += -msse -msse2 -msse3 -msimd128 -else -BASE_OPTS += -msse -msse2 -mfpmath=sse -endif -endif - -ifeq ($(CPU_ARM),true) -ifneq ($(CPU_ARM64),true) +BASE_OPTS += -msse -msse2 -msse3 -msimd128 +else ifeq ($(CPU_ARM32),true) BASE_OPTS += -mfpu=neon-vfpv4 -mfloat-abi=hard -endif +else ifeq ($(CPU_I386_OR_X86_64),true) +BASE_OPTS += -mtune=generic -msse -msse2 -mfpmath=sse endif ifeq ($(MACOS),true)